The Cowboys need to hit it big in free agency if they want to be Super Bowl contenders next year. Here are five high-quality targets for Dallas. 

Free agency isn’t the most efficient means of improving a roster for any NFL team, but the Cowboys have the advantage of being a big draw for stars hitting the open market. The key for Dallas’ front office is to avoid overpaying big names just because they might excite the fan base.

This offseason the Cowboys should narrow their free agent focus on filling obvious holes in the roster. Dak Prescott needs to see one or two quality wide receivers added to his receiving corps. The defense can use help at defensive tackle and linebacker.

It might not be possible for Dallas to fill all their needs via free agency but landing any of the following five players would be a solid step in the right direction.

5. Sheldon Rankins

Signing a solid starter at defensive tackle isn’t going to electrify the Cowboys’ fan base, but it would make defensive coordinator Dan Quinn pretty happy. He understands the clear need for Dallas to strengthen its run-stopping ability up front.

Rankins isn’t a star pass-rusher or run-stopper but he provides real value because he’s solid in both phases of play. The Cowboys can deploy him in the middle of their defensive line with the confidence that he can hold up as a true three-down player.

Combine that with the reality that the market for defensive tackles is only increasing around the league and it’s easy to see why Rankins will generate interest from multiple teams. The Cowboys need to move quickly if they want to add Rankins to their starting lineup next season.
